Combine like terms.

- 2/3p + 1/5 - 1 + 5/6p

Answer:

1/6 p -4/5

Explanation:

- 2/3p + 1/5 - 1 + 5/6p

When I combine like terms, I put them next to each other.

- 2/3p + 5/6p+ 1/5 - 1

We need to get a common denominator of 6 for the p terms

-2/3 *2/2 p + 5/6 p

-4/6p + 5/6 p

1/6 p


We need to get a common denominator of 5 for the contant terms

1/5 - 1*5/5

1/5-5/5

-4/5


Substituting these in

2/3p + 5/6p+ 1/5 - 1

1/6 p -4/5
